Planning a return trip in September 5 nights/6 days and want input on where we should eat this time.
It would be me and my husband and our 5 year old and almost 3 year old. We would like to celebrate the 3 year olds birthday one night too. They are both boys.
Where we ate last trip:
Sunshine Seasons - Lunch was pretty good here. We all enjoyed this.
Garden Grill in EPCOT - Best meal we had all week. Service and food was excellent.
Tusker House in AK- Loved the food, but the service was horrible. Like beyond horrible that my husband said he never wants to go back. =/
Pecos Bills in MK - It was ok, but not stellar. The guy brought my son a sheriff badge which was pretty cool.
BOG Lunch - I liked the turkey, husband wasnt fond of the steak but overall it was pretty good and its beautiful in there.
50s prime time - Food was good, dessert was good, service was pretty good.
We are planning two days in MK, two in Epcot, and one in Animal Kingdom and Hollywood Studios. We are ok with going to resorts for food as well.
We are going to be on the DDP.
My 2.5 year old loves Mickey and Pluto... that is all he has talked about since coming back. My 5 year old likes everyone but especially Donald, and Stitch.
Places I am considering: Chef Mickeys (a little worried about reviews), Ohana, Wilderness Lodge, Hoop De Du, Boma, Whispering Canyon. We will go back to Garden Grill for one of our days at Epcot, but not so sure about the other night there. if you had to create a schedule for 5 days, what would you pick with lunch/dinner?
